Adventure Valley boasts a paintball park with 6 fields, 2 woods-ball fields, and 2 ziplines over a field for scenario play. The paintball park also has a "king of the hill" scenario woods-ball field. The zipline tour stretches over 1 1/2 miles, including a 1,100 foot long “super-zip” with speeds of 40-50 mph! Open without reservations on weekends.
The park is only 30 minutes from downtown and 20 minutes from West and South County. The park sits on 90 acres with a beautiful natural spring and stream, ideal for picnics. Adventure Valley is the perfect choice for families and those of all ages.
From Hwy 270 and 30 (Gravois): West on Hwy 30 for 13 miles to Hwy MM, left on MM for 4 miles to Adventure Valley. From 270 and 21: Southwest on Hwy 21 for 13 miles to Hwy MM, right on MM for 1/4 mile. From 270 and 55: South on Hwy 55 for 12 miles to Hwy M, right for 7.8 miles to Adventure Valley.
Age minimum: 12
Guests under 18 years of age must have signed waiver from parent or legal guardian

The Gateway Arch is a 630-foot-tall monument in St. Louis, symbolizing the westward expansion of the United States. Visitors can take a tram ride to the top for stunning views of the city and the Mississippi River.
One of the oldest and largest zoos in the United States, the Kansas City Zoo is home to over 1,700 animals and features a variety of exhibits, including a safari experience and a penguin habitat.
This museum complex in Hannibal, Missouri, preserves the childhood home and inspirations of the famous author Mark Twain. Visitors can explore his boyhood home, the museum, and other historic sites related to his life and works.
Bridal Cave is a stunning limestone cave system near Camdenton, Missouri. Visitors can take guided tours through the cave and explore the scenic Thunder Mountain Park, which offers hiking trails and picnic areas.
Silver Dollar City is an 1880s-style theme park in Branson, Missouri, featuring live entertainment, craft demonstrations, and a variety of rides and attractions. The park is known for its unique blend of history, culture, and thrilling rides.

A St. Louis specialty, toasted ravioli are fried pasta pockets filled with cheese, meat, or vegetables, served with marinara sauce for dipping.
A thin, cracker-like crust topped with Provel cheese, a processed cheese blend unique to St. Louis. The pizza is typically cut into squares and topped with a variety of ingredients.

Hannibal is a charming river town on the banks of the Mississippi, known as the boyhood home of Mark Twain. Visitors can explore the author's childhood home, the museum, and other historic sites related to his life and works.
Branson is a popular tourist destination in the Ozark Mountains, known for its live music shows, theme parks, and outdoor activities. The city is home to numerous theaters, museums, and attractions, making it a great destination for families and groups.
Elephant Rocks State Park is a scenic park in the Ozark Mountains, featuring unique rock formations, hiking trails, and picnic areas. The park is named for a massive granite boulder that resembles an elephant.
